DESCRIPTION:This event is for members of the Tyneside Fiddle Alliance\, Hexham Village Band\, Phoenix Chamber Folk Ensemble\, Redheughers Ceilidh Band\, Glendale Community Band and The Keel Assembly \nWhat We Do! \nA celebration of community folk ensembles across the North East \nSunday 28th June 2026 (1.20pm – 9.30pm)\nSt Bartholomew’s Church Hall\, Benton \nThis event will bring together some of the largest community folk ensembles in the North East: Tyneside Fiddle Alliance\, Hexham Village Band\, Phoenix Chamber Folk Ensemble\, Redheughers Ceilidh Band\, Glendale Community Band and the newly formed Keel Assembly. It is open to all members of these ensembles\, and will be an opportunity to play together\, share some favourite repertoire and perform to each other. \nSession (1.20pm – 1.50pm)\nFor those who would like to start the afternoon with a session\, David Oliver will lead us in some session tunes. \nPlaying together (1.50pm – 5.30pm)\nDuring the afternoon\, leaders of TFA\, HVB\, PCFE and Redheughers will take it in turn to teach the whole group one or two favourite tunes and/or arrangements from their ensemble repertoire. There will be a break in the middle for refreshments. \nSupper (5.30-6.30pm)\nFor those that want to\, we are organising a fish ‘n’ chip supper\, which will be delivered to the venue. You are also welcome to bring your own food\, or to leave and return in time for the evening session. \nEvening concert and ceilidh (7pm – 9.30pm)\nThe first part of the evening will be a concert featuring performances from TFA\, PFCE\, Redheughers and GCB. We will reorganise the room during the interval\, so that the Hexham Village Band can lead us all in some ceilidh dancing. We will finish the evening off with some session tunes. \nTickets available from:\nhttps://phoenixfolk.co.uk/events/whatwedo/
